Swedish death metal band DEMONICAL returns with a surprise new EP “Into Victory”, featuring one new, original track and a cover of Ramones‘ song. The EP is due tomorrow, March 31st, on Agonia Records in CD and digital. Its title track received a lyric video, which is premiering now, watch below.
The new material marks a line-up change, with the band debuting a new singer. “With the release of ‘Into Victory’, we hereby welcome Charlie Fryksell as our new vocalist,” comments DEMONICAL. “Like an unstoppable force, we will push on towards new greater goals and this EP is another step on that path. So ladies and gentlemen, join us in death!”
“Into Victory” followed the footsteps of “Mass Destroyer” (2022) to Glashuset and Sellnoise Studios, where it was recorded & produced by DEMONICAL, Jonas Arnberg and Johan Hjelm. Mixing and mastering was done by Ronnie Bjornstrom at BLP Studios (Meshuggah, Blood Red Throne). The cover artwork was painted by Belial Necroarts.

Nine years since the first installment of ‘The Singularity Trilogy’, virtuosic progressive metallers SCAR SYMMETRY, who recently re-signed to Nuclear Blast Records, have announced The Singularity (Phase II – Xenotaph) which will be released on 9th June. To coincide with the announcement, the band have also released the video for the albums first single ‘Scorched Quadrant’.
In the wake of the announcement, band mastermind Per Nilsson comments “It brings us the utmost pleasure and pride to announce the long-awaited and much-teased ‘Phase II’ to the world along with its first single! It’s been a long time coming but I’m glad that we went the extra mile to make everything as perfect as we felt it needed to be.  The world is a different place in 2023 than it was in 2014 when ‘Neohumanity’ was released… We see the rise of AI before our very eyes and while we all look in awe at the wonders it can create it is easy to think of some very disturbing scenarios. In our new album, we once again explore these themes of neohumanity, artificial intelligence and the technological singularity from a dystopian point of view.  The AI-enhanced neohumans are waging war upon the unmodified majority of mankind who don’t stand a chance against their technologically superior oppressors, until one day, a glimmer of salvation appears in the night sky. Almost impossible to first take in; as an utterly alien mirage, seemingly out of nowhere mysterious, giant spacecrafts silently emerge from the heavens. Travelers both intergalactic and interdimensional, these ultraterrestrial beings who have been watching mankind for millennia seem to have decided to not sit idle while the technocalyptic cybergeddon is ravaging our planet.  We recently renewed our vows with Nuclear Blast and we’re very thrilled about moving on to this next phase (ahem) of our career with them by our side!  The ‘Phase II’ touring cycle starts today and fittingly, we begin with a tour supporting my former employers Meshuggah! We hope to see you all on the road soon, but until then, here’s Scorched Quadrant!”

Formed in Sweden in 2004, SCAR SYMMETRY were a unique proposition from the start. Although clearly owing a debt to the pioneering melodic death metal bands of the â90s, guitarist Per Nilsson and his comrades were walking their own evolutionary path. As showcased on 2005 debut Symmetric In Design, the band were driven by fervently progressive and proudly melodic instincts, infusing their often brutal riffs and arrangements with wild, futuristic atmospherics, and sublime, emotional melodies that always hit their targets with ruthless precision.
As SCAR SYMMETRY moved forward, their music continued to evolve in tandem. They joined forces with Nuclear Blast Records for 2006âs breakthrough opus Pitch Black Progress (2006), and have since amassed an extraordinary catalogue of forward-thinking but irrevocably crushing modern metal. From the glossy, hyper-melodic barrage of Holographic Universe (2008), to the immaculate thunder of The Unseen Empire (2011) and the astonishing, cosmic odyssey that is The Singularity (Phase I – Neohumanity) (2014). the Swedes have blown minds and enhanced their reputation with every artistic step.

Modern symphonic metal band AD INFINITUM is back to make a stand with their eagerly anticipated third record, Chapter lll â Downfall, out today via Napalm Records! Along with the album release, the four-piece presents the stunning album opener, âEternal Rainsâ, as their fifth single off of the new offering. The song is represented by an impressively powerful music video that showcases AD INFINITUM as the energetic entity that they are celebrated as by their devotees.  Shimmering âEternal Rainsâ proves the modern symphonic metal four-piece to be on top of their game, whirling the genre with their inimitable sound, topped by a breathtaking vocal performance by matchless rising star Melissa Bonny. This exciting ride showcases the massive talent of this uprising outfit, fanning the flames of a bright future!
AD INFINITUM on âEternal Rainsâ: âAfter the fire, here comes the rain! Today is the day, our third album Chapter III – Downfall is out. We decided to feature one more song with a music video: âEternal Rainsâ. âEternal Rainsâ is the opening track of this new record and sets the tone with a diverse palette of sounds and energies. Enjoy the new album, happy release day!â
Chapter III â Downfall bewitches with an innovative sound full of soaring melodic splendor juxtaposed against brooding, dark and even gothic heaviness. Exploring concepts of Ancient Egyptian history and mythology, AD INFINITUM melds a perfect balance of storytelling and technically sophisticated songwriting, spreading their wings in both areas of production and lyricism. Charging instrumentals, pounding drums, chunky, grooving riffs, mind-boggling solos and enchanting orchestrations build the band’s unique world of sound as frontwoman-to-watch Melissa Bonnyâs soul-stirring cleans and haunting growls put her incredible vocal range on display – dropping jaws with each line.  Produced by AD INFINITUM and Jacob Hansen at Hansen Studios, Chapter III â Downfall showcases that this up-and-coming quartet can effortlessly turn the genre upside down, gracing it with contemporary vibes without forgoing their signature metal origins, and thrilling all metal fans as they rise to the top!Â
AD INFINITUM add: âFor this album, we explored stories and legends of Ancient Egypt with, as star character and main inspiration, Cleopatra. We added some extra dimension and sounds to our signature AD INFINITUM sound to create an extra dimension, transporting the listener to mystical landscapes of another era. We are beyond excited to unveil this new record!â
Electric âUpside Downâ showcases the addictive formula of AD INFINITUM while defying all rules, combining epic melodies and demonic growls with finesse. âFrom The Ashesâ impresses with reminiscence of artists like Meshuggah, proving that AD INFINITUM never fails to deliver surprises. âUnder The Burning Skiesâ directs its haunting vocals towards the horizon, unfolding into an intense mid-tempo ballad shortly after. As a special treat, AD INFINITUM welcomes Chrigel Glanzmann of Eluveitie, who provides his voice for the atmospheric monologue introduction on âLegendsâ, paving the way for a touch of Middle Eastern-inspired djent flavor.

Queens, New York based rock outfit KING FALCON have released their new song âCadillacâ on Mascot Records. Melding indie-rock adventurousness with Classic Rock swagger, King Falconâs ultra-catchy songwriting recalls artists like Black Keys, Cage The Elephant, Tame Impala, The Killers, Royal Blood, and Beck.Â
âCadillacâ was produced by Marshall Altman (Citizen Cope, Matt Nathanson, Kenny Wayne Shepherd, Mark Broussard) and mixed by 12-time Grammy-nominated mixing engineer and producer Mark Needham (The Killers, Imagine Dragons, Fleetwood Mac, The Airborne Toxic Event). The song is brimming with earworm-worthy guitar riffage, a soaring chorus, soulfully melodic lead vocals, and vibrant indie-rock atmospherics.
In talking about the genesis of âCadillacâ, King Falconâs Michael Rubin says âMy best friend has had this 1957 Cadillac Eldorado parked in his garage for as long as Iâve known him. Every single time that we saw each other, I would   pester him about trying to get it started so we could take it for a joyride. The car hadnât moved in years – but it wasnât in bad shape or anything, it had just atrophied as all mechanical things tend to do when they sit around unused and unlovedâ.  He continues âOne day I decided to take matters into my own hands. I showed up at his house with a couple of tools and a can of starter fluid and before you know it, we were cruisinâ down the boulevard in this unregistered Cadillac with 40 year old tires. Totally unsafe and illegal, but it was the single most fun I have ever had riding in a car. That old Caddy turns WAY more heads than any new Lamborghini or Ferrari!  The second I heard the engine roar to life I knew that this was a special moment that I wanted to write about. The song came together after about 8 days of sitting in front of my computer screen listening to the bass part on loop (much to the chagrin of my neighbors). I felt that the song had to embody the coolness of the moment but also the excitement and danger of driving around in a 5000 pound car with crappy brakes and no license platesâ.  The âCadillacâ video snapshots an actual Ferris Bueller-like joyride with his buddyâs red, rare bird 1957 Eldorado Cadillac. Rubin continues âI got to drive this beauty with no brakes, no plates, and a flat tireâeverybody, including the cops, waved as I cruised this spaceship around the neighborhood. It broke down twice while we were filming, and we had to push that two and a half ton beast uphill on a gravel road. I now have a chronic injury from doing that â as a reminder of an experience I will never forget. We were able to mix in some cool animation to enhance the storyline of the video, we hope everyone enjoys it!â
Michael Rubin is the creative driving force behind King Falcon, but drummer and sometimes recording engineer James Terranova is essential to the bandâs spirit. His fastidious, plan-ahead persona is the perfect counterpoint to Michaelâs freewheeling personality, and the pair have an old-married-couple kind of connection. âI would take a bullet for him, but I may also be that person to shoot him,â Michael jokes. Up until now, King Falcon has been a guitar and drums duo, but the twosome is welcoming drummer Tom Diognardi and moving James to bass.  In 2020, the duo released the funky and infectiously catchy single, âShake! Shake! Shake!â However, the pandemic cleared King Falconâs calendar before it even got a chance to play a show. The guys made the most of the situation by sending the unreleased song, âWhen The Party Is Over,â out to labels. âThat song represented me trying to convince my parents, and myself, that I could get somewhere playing guitar,â Michael says. The song turned out to be aces for the band – they emailed the song to Mascot, and the next day was awarded with a recording contract.   âWhen The Party Is Overâ is an irresistible, moody mid-tempo rocker teeming with ear worm melodies. The song explores lonely New York late-night living with gritty candor, and it comes alive via a darkly alluring video. âWe got chased through the park by a crazed man with a knife while making the songâs video,â Michael remembers.Â
King Falcon has resumed its pre-pandemic plans of playing its first live shows and touring. âIt took two and a half years to get here,â Michael says, pausing thoughtfully. âIf you asked me when I first got my guitar if we would get a label and be where we are today, I would have said, âoh yeah, no problem,â but Iâve learned the reality of it all isnât that simple. It is amazing to be where we are today, but it was definitely a challenging journey.â  The band is set to start a 3 month residency at the famed Bowery Electric in NYC, with tour dates being booked for the summer and plans to release additional music later this year.

Dark singer-songwriter THE DEVIL’S TRADE has teamed up with industrial noise artist JOHN CXNNOR for the recording of a brand new live album, ‘John Cxnnor X The Devilâs Trade – Live at Roadburn!’ The album was recorded during the artists’ performance at the 2022 edition of Roadburn and will be released on April 21, 2023 via Season of Mist (digital) and Pelagic Records (physical). For over two decades, Roadburn Festival has been a driving force in the international music scene. The organization, led by artistic director Walter Hoejimakers, commissions special pieces and collaborations under the motto of “Redefining Heaviness” in order to stimulate innovation and creativity in the underground music scene. The convergence of Danish electro-industrial duo John Cxnnor with Hungarian doom-folk artist The Devilâs Trade is one prime example of how powerful these collaborations can be, and those who were present at this already legendary show in Tilburg can attest to that.

For his newest track “PROTOCOL: PHANTOM”, Caster enters the world of Cyberpunk on FiXT‘s new Altered compilation series. From start to finish the track is a storm fueled by gritty guitars and heavy rhythms, layered with synthesizers and a haunting bridge that spins away from the heavy sound into the ethereal before diving back into an aggressive inferno.  Polish producer Paul Szeligowski, better known as Caster is one of the fastest up-and-coming artists in electronic music.  Residing in London UK, Paul has quickly captivated the interests of many fans with his haunting sound, blending bass music with the horror genre. In just a short span Caster has accumulated millions of plays across many platforms, even gaining the attention of Excision and Seven Lions, as he continues to release music on their respective labels, Subsidia Records and Ophelia Records as well as other renown labels like, Monstercat, New Dawn, GRVDNCR, and Theracords. Casterâs witchcraft branding and storytelling music have gained him a true cult following. As his fans continue to listen to uncover the mysteries of Caster, his growth as an artist accelerates to becoming one of the most innovative electronic music producers of his generation.
